My eyes were witnessing

something I had never

seen before.






As I tilted my head

looking up, my eyes

followed this tall, large,

gold gate that was before me.


It was nothing but

made out of pure gold.

This golden gate was

so vast. The golden gate

connected to a fence. This

golden fence stretched out

for miles. It went far to the

left and far to the right. It

had no end. The gate entrances

itself was so tall, I saw no

top to it.


I then heard a loud sound.

It was the sound of a latch

unlocking. The gate before

me began too slowly open.

For a split moment, I felt

as if I were part of a royal

family.


As I entered, I was greeted

by a large masculine figure.

He instantly magnetized to

my side. He gently took a

grasp of my small hand. I felt

his large warm hand, yet did

not feel any romantic feelings.


As he looked into my eyes,

a clear message was communicated.

The power of hie eyes made words

powerless. The way he looked at me

I knew. I knew from then on out,

he was going to be my guide. I also

knew then, he had protected me

my whole life. He was my guardian

angel.


After I entered, the gates,

they closed behind me. The

gate then locked loudly. Though

it was a loud noise, I did not

shudder. In fact, I did not even

blink. In this world, words such

as fear and anxiety did not exist.


The angel then began to

guide me. For miles around

me, I saw nothing but pure green.

It was as if a vast green banket

overwhelmed the hills around me.


There were these massive trees.

I had never seen such a large

plant before. It made me feel

as if I were a tiny doll, playing in

a doll house's large background.


The trees were so large and

the hills were so green, you

would doubt their existence.

Each tree contained its own

unique color of fruit. My eyes

had never seen such vibrant

colors. Surrounding the trees

were large bodies of water.


The water made me feel

as if I were at the Bahamas.

The clear, blue water practically

was screaming at me.


I then was caught off guard as

I noticed something quite strange.

I saw dozens of these large, white

buildings. They looked like

white mansions.


I had not seen such a pure,

white building before. They

had no blemish. I then realized

these mansions had something

in common. These mansions

did not have doors nor windows.

There were openings, but nothing

to keep you from entering. For

there were no windows to lock.


This was because there was

no need for either. In this world

you did not think about security.

Though I did not recognize anything,

I felt no urge to ask any questions.

I felt no stress, anxiety, worry or fear.

Here, I felt an unexplainable peace.

Though I did not understand fully,

I had a fulfilling understanding.


The guardian took me to

a body of water. He told me

to lean over and take a drink.

As I looked into the water,

rather than seeing myself,

I saw nothing. I looked back

at the guardian. He gestured me

to look back into the water.


As I looked back into the water,

I saw a face. A face of a

man, I had never seen before.

He had tan skin and short

dark hair. As I studied his features

he had thick, curly hair. He had

some scruffs on his chin.


I was then in awe as I

saw his eyes. He had eyes

that were a thousand colors.

His eyes had hints of gold,

green, blues and browns.

I could not explain it. It was

a beautiful, mysterious combination.

These eyes reminded me of

different people I had

known in life.


The face disappeared. I then

lowered my hand into the water.

I cupped my hand, capturing water

in my palm. It is like the blue water

was glistening before my eyes. As

the water touched my lips and

slid down my throat, I was astonished.

I had never tasted such pure, refreshing,

sweet water. After, one small scoop,

I was no longer thirsty.


The angel then led me back on

the golden path. We made our way to

one of the many mansions. The guardian

stopped in front of a mansion. He looked

at me and said, "This is yours." He helped

me up the few steps. I rubbed my hand

on one of the major white pillars that

welcomed me. I easily entered as there

was no door to unlock or open.


As soon as I entered the mansion,

it was such a perfect temperature. I took

a whiff and it smelled so fresh, clean

and sweet at the same time. Right at

the entrance there was a beautiful

rock fountain. It contained the same

waster that I drank earlier.


I looked around and saw golden

color ceilings, blue and purple

walls and many plants. In a way,

it felt like my own personal get

away and a resort. It had so many

plants with fruit it was like

my own personal grocery store.


As I toured the home, there was

an opening with comfortable seats

and couches. Yet, there was no TV,

books nor magazines. To the left there

was this huge kitchen. It contained

white marble counter tops. To

my surprise there was no refrigerator,

stove or dishwasher. Yet, there was

a ton of fresh food on the table.


As I looked at the table, it

had foods and fruits I had

never seen or smelt before.

The fruit had no blemish. In the

middle of the table, there was a

large fresh loaf of bread. The closer

I got; the smell overwhelmed my spirit.


As I went upstairs, there were many rooms

and bathrooms. Yet, I noticed one thing

was missing. There was no bed. Yet, at

this place, I felt no sleepiness or dreariness.

In fact, I had so much energy, I felt I could

run a marathon! Each room had it's own

unique color scheme and furniture.


The guardian led me back down

the stairs. I headed to the table to

get some refreshments. As I made

my way to the table, something large

and soft rubbed against my side. The

soft material touched my hand, it felt

like silk. As I looked down to see what

touched me, I was amazed.


It was the most beautiful animal

I had ever seen. It was a large

white tiger, with eyes of gold. Rather

than feeling any fear or uncertainty,

I was full of love and peace. The tiger

made its way to the den and layed down.

As I went to get a piece of bread,

something flew over my head in a hurry.


I followed the sound that passed

over my head. It was a beautiful,

tiny, yellow bird. I found it odd

because both of the animals

had a golden tint in their eyes.

I instantly was reminded of the

face I had seen in the water. He

too had a golden tint.


I then got this random, powerful

urge to praise the animals I had

seen. My eyes followed the yellow

bird as he flew out one of the

openings in the walls. As my eyes

followed the bird out the window,

I saw the back of a tall figure, with

a clean white robe on.


I then strangely had the overwhelming

feeling to go to him. Though I did not

know who he was, I felt an odd connection

with him. I felt in a way, I had known

him my whole life too. I urgently left

the guardian and the house. I began

to run towards him.


As I ran towards him, I then saw

thousands of people around. There

were many different small groups.

All of them were talking and

laughing amongst themselves. Yet,

this man was alone near a tree.


When I finally reached him, I

stopped. I was not out of breathe

nor sweaty. I realized he had short,

thick curly, dark hair. He still was facing

towards the tree. I slowly began to extend

my right arm to tough him on his back.


Right before I touched him, he turned

around. I instantly realized, he was the

strange face I had seen in the water. He

was the one with the eyes of a thousand

colors. He was the one who had perfect

tan skin. I then knew exactly who He was.


Uncontrollably, my knees locked and

hit the ground beneath me. I felt waves

of overwhelming. These waves contained

feelings of love, joy, peace, grace and security.


He reached down and helped me up

with His hands. His hands were warm

and were both marked with a scar.


He smiled, looked int my eyes

and said, "Well done my good and

faithful servant."
